Dubai Chambers hosts four legal workshops to guide businesses through key regulatory developments

  • Sessions covering bankruptcy, M&A, corporate compliance, and maritime law attracted over 170 members of the business community.

 


Dubai, UAE – Dubai Chambers successfully organised four legal and compliance-focused workshops in October, designed to equip the business community with essential knowledge on the UAE's evolving regulatory landscape. The sessions covered critical topics including the UAE Bankruptcy Law, mergers and acquisitions, corporate compliance, and shipping and logistics law, attracting strong engagement with over 170 participants in total.
 


The first workshop which focused on Bankruptcy Law in UAE was held in collaboration with Hadef and Partners. The session offered a detailed examination of the current bankruptcy law, exploring the three key proceedings available to distressed businesses: preventive settlement, restructuring, and bankruptcy. Participants gained valuable insights into recent precedent-setting cases, personal liability risks for directors, and practical considerations for navigating the modern business protection framework.
 


In partnership with Hamdan AlShamsi Lawyers & Legal Consultants, the second webinar raised awareness on the need for companies to stay ahead of changing corporate compliance laws. The session explored recent legal developments including ultimate beneficial ownership and economic substance regulations, anti-money laundering requirements, and key updates to employment and data protection laws.
 


The third workshop was organised in collaboration with Habib Al Mulla and Partners, provided a comprehensive overview of the key legal, practical, and strategic aspects of domestic and cross-border merger and acquisition (M&A) deals. Attendees strengthened their ability to navigate the life cycle of an M&A transaction, understand relevant risks, and plan strategically in the changing geopolitical environment.
 


Together with Aramex and Al Tamimi & Co, the final workshop offered a comprehensive exploration of the legal and operational landscape of the shipping and logistics sector. The session addressed key regulatory requirements, common operational challenges, and emerging industry opportunities, equipping attendees to navigate the complexities of the sector and support informed decision-making.
 


These workshops underscore Dubai Chambers’ ongoing commitment to supporting the business community by providing timely guidance on the latest legal and compliance updates. By fostering a deeper understanding of complex regulatory requirements, Dubai Chambers aims to enhance the competitiveness of businesses operating in the emirate and contribute to their long-term sustainable growth.
